Denmark's expedition leaves for Arctic to stake claim
Source: Xinhua

2007-08-12 13:40:06

STOCKHOLM, Aug. 12 -- Denmark sent a scientific expedition to the Arctic Sunday, joining the competition to stake claims over rights to the huge fuel and mineral resources under the North Pole's seabed, Danish news media reported.

The expedition is aimed at seeking evidence that the Lomonosov Ridge, a 1,240-mile (1,995-km) underwater mountain range, is attached to the Danish territory of Greenland, making it a geological extension of the Arctic island.

With the help of Sweden, the scientists set off from Norway's remote Arctic islands of Svalbard aboard the Swedish icebreaker Oden on the month-long expedition.

The team, composed of 40 scientists, 10 of them Danish, will employ sophisticated equipment, including sonar, to map the seabed under the ice of the Arctic. The expedition is expected to cost more than 11 million U.S. dollars. ~snip~

6. There's still a bit of uncertainty about that expedition
Edited on Mon Aug-13-07 02:03 AM by KDLarsen
The Danish PM have stated that the north pole should be collectively owned by all of the world, and that no single nation should be able to claim it. The danish minister of science, however, have stated that it's the intention of the expedition to be able to make a claim of the north pole.
